A car has ploughed into pedestrians outside a mosque in Birmingham, leaving multiple people injured.
The car crashed into two men outside Shah Jalal mosque on Ettington Road in Aston this afternoon before speeding away.
Two people were hurt before the car, which is believed to be silver, accelerated away from the scene.
Police are now hunting the driver and said they are not ruling “in or out” terror as a motive.
Officers from West Midlands Police said they were called to the scene at about 2.15pm after they received reports that two men in their 20s had been hurt.
